Looking ahead to the upcoming fixture list, our predictive models have highlighted several standout opportunities across Europe's top leagues. In the Primera Division on Wednesday, August 19, 2026, Club Atlético de Madrid host Málaga CF. The numbers heavily favor the hosts, giving a 72% probability to a home win. Furthermore, our metrics suggest a brisk start with a 75% chance of a first-half goal, alongside a strong 70% expectation for over 2.5 cards, pointing toward a physical encounter where Atlético should assert early dominance.

Moving deeper into the week, the analytical landscape shifts. On Thursday, August 20, Rayo Vallecano face Deportivo Alavés, where our model surprisingly identifies an away win probability of 52%, making it one of the weekend's tighter contests for bettors seeking value outside conventional home favorites. Meanwhile, in Ligue 1 on Friday, August 21, Olympique de Marseille welcome RC Strasbourg Alsace. Marseille are priced at a 58% home win probability, with metrics also indicating a 74% likelihood of a first-half breakthrough and a solid 62% projection for over 8.5 corners.

In the Premier League, Arsenal host Coventry City FC on Friday night in what stands as the weekend's most lopsided fixture according to our data. The Gunners hold an 82% chance of victory, backed by an 80% probability for a first-half goal. Conversely, matchups like Real Betis versus Real Sociedad present a lower-scoring outlook, with our model favoring an under 2.5 goals line at 54% and a high cards projection of 78% over 2.5 bookings, indicating a cautious, tightly contested derby style affair.

Saturday's schedule brings further intrigue as Manchester United travel to Hull City AFC, where the away side is projected at a 62% win probability. Further down the card, Ipswich Town meet Sunderland and Everton face Crystal Palace, offering diverse betting angles ranging from corner totals to both-teams-to-score probabilities.
